Мое приложение для iOS было отклонено из-за неверного SYMLINK

У меня есть приложение, которое использует статическую библиотеку и расширение. После того, как я собрал его и загрузил в Appstore, я получил письмо со следующим:

Неверная символическая ссылка - Ваш пакет содержит символическую ссылку "ApptentiveResources.bundle/ApptentiveResources.bundle", которая разрешается в местоположение "/ Пользователи / администратор / Библиотека / Разработчик /Xcode/DerivedData/APPNAME-deobhgkhragul tfojmikyyibbvNx / APD / Intermediates / ArchiveP / IntermediateBuildFilesPath / UninstalledProducts / ApptentiveResources.bundle ', который не существует или находится вне пакета.

Неверная символическая ссылка - Ваш пакет содержит символическую ссылку "Подключаемые модули / Поделиться с APPNAME.appex/ Поделиться с APPNAME.appex", которая преобразуется в местоположение "/ Пользователи / администратор / Библиотека / Разработчик /Xcode/DerivedData/APPNAME-deobhgkhragul tfojmikyyibbvsx/Build/Intermediates/ArchiveIntermediates/APPNAME/IntermediateBuildFilesPath/UninstalledProducts/ Поделиться с APPNAME.appex', который не существует или находится вне пакета.

Есть идеи что делать?

2 ответа

Удалите недопустимую символическую ссылку и повторно отправьте

С марта 2014 года приложения, использующие известный обходной путь символьных ссылок, не перейдут к обзору.

Я предполагаю, что вы использовали этот обходной путь в своем приложении.

Обходной путь обсуждается в ответе на эту ссылку;

Добавление символической ссылки в комплект приложений

Другие вопросы по тегам